Questo articolo è stato tradotto automaticamente. Per visualizzare l'articolo in inglese, selezionare la casella di controllo Inglese. È possibile anche visualizzare il testo inglese in una finestra popup posizionando il puntatore del mouse sopra il testo.
Traduzione
Inglese

Metodo DetailsView.CreateChildControls (IEnumerable, Boolean)

 

Data di pubblicazione: ottobre 2016

Crea la gerarchia dei controlli per eseguire il rendering di DetailsView controllo.

Spazio dei nomi:   System.Web.UI.WebControls
Assembly:  System.Web (in System.Web.dll)

protected override int CreateChildControls(
	IEnumerable dataSource,
	bool dataBinding
)

Parametri

dataSource
Type: System.Collections.IEnumerable

Un IEnumerable che rappresenta l'origine dati per il DetailsView controllo.

dataBinding
Type: System.Boolean

true per indicare che questo metodo viene chiamato durante l'associazione dati. in caso contrario, false.

Valore restituito

Type: System.Int32

Il numero di elementi nell'origine dati.

Exception Condition
HttpException

dataSource Restituisce un valore null DataSourceView.

-oppure-

dataSource non è un ICollection e non può restituire il numero totale di righe.

-oppure-

dataBinding è false e dataSource non implementa il ICollection interfaccia.

-oppure-

dataSource non implementa il ICollection interfaccia e AllowPaging è impostato su true.

Il CreateChildControls è chiamato da un metodo di supporto di DetailsView controllo per creare la gerarchia dei controlli per il controllo.

Note per gli eredi:

Quando si estende il DetailsView (classe), è possibile sostituire questo metodo per creare una propria gerarchia dei controlli.

.NET Framework
Disponibile da 2.0
Torna all'inizio
Mostra: